This popped up on social media showing a Venn diagram of which Beatles were not on various recordings.

Can’t vouch for its accuracy. For example it’s not clear that Paul wasn’t on She Said She Said. He played on some takes before storming out but I don’t think it’s confirmed if any of his bass was used in the released version.

I'm Looking Through You has all four Beatles on it.

You can hear Lennon singing harmony and it even has Ringo on organ  - playing mainly one note ! He also reportedl overdubbed himself tapping on a matchbox ...

One song that should probably be on there is Old Brown Shoe but I daren't say where, otherwise you'll get ten pages of debate as to who was playing drums
